Preventative Maintenance Tips

Book pumping every 3 years for typical households, more often if you use a garbage disposal or have a big family. Spread laundry loads to reduce hydraulic shock. Avoid bleach-heavy cleaners and marketed as flushable wipesthey stress the system.

Move roof and surface water away from the drain field. Keep a grass cover over the field; avoid heavy vehicles or sheds on top. Log service dates and keep maps handy so every tech knows the layout quickly.

When It Is an Emergency

Gurgling drains, sewage odors, or slow sinks mean it is time to call. Limit water use, avoid dishwashers and washers, and we will dispatch a crew. We arrive with jetting gear so we can restore flow fast.

If the yard is soggy or wet near the field, we assess saturation, cover the area, and plan rehab steps that revive percolation without jumping straight to replacement.

The drain field is out of sight, yet it is the backbone of your septic system. We coach Tracy, CA property owners to protect it by maintaining grass cover, diverting roof water, and not placing heavy loads. If percolation slows, we treat lines, tune dosing, and check recovery before recommending replacement.

Tracy is the second most populated city in San Joaquin County, California, United States. The population was 93,000 at the 2020 census. Tracy is located inside a geographic triangle formed by Interstate 205 on the north side of the city, Interstate 5 to the east, and Interstate 580 to the southwest.
